Stanny identifies seven key strategies that high-earning women employ: Profit Motive, Audacity, Resilience, Encouragement, Self-Awareness, Non-Attachment, and Financial Know-How. Through extensive research and interviews with over 150 successful women, her writing demystifies their success.
